Meander 2 - Christmas Stockings - Every year I do stockings for the family. There are many to fill. Every year I say I'll buy things all year and make things easier. Unfortunately I forget and end up running around like a nut trying to find small, inexpensive, useful and fun items for the stockings. This year I've found some really odd things. What about plastic storage bags that don't lay flat but stand like jars. I found that to be most clever. There are some neat paper clips I found, too. Other things are more ordinary but still fun. Like a bit of candy for each person and gift cards for underwear, and stuff for lips. This year I found some even the boys will use. Seven are completed and ready to mail to far off states. That leaves nine more to go. Once the others are mailed, I'll start on those. Then I can get on with other Christmas preparations.
